Agrochemical Herbicide Pyrazosulfuron-Ethyl CAS 93697-74-6

• CAS NO: 93697-74-6

• Molecular Weight: 414.399

• EINECS: 618-964-1

• Chemical Name: Pyrazosulfuron-ethyl

• Molecular Formula: C14H18N6O7S

• Mol File: 93697-74-6.mol

• Hs Code: 29350090

    Properties

    • Melting Point: 180-182 °C 
    • Refractive Index: 1.44 
    • Flash Point170°C 
    • PSA172.01000 
    • PKA12.06±0.70(Predicted) 
    • Appearance: Off-white loosen powder
    • Density: 1.55 g/cm3 
    • Storage Temp.: 0-6°C 
    • Water Solubility: DMSO (Slightly), Methanol (Slightly, Heated) 
    • LogP: 1.45910 
    • Exact Mass414.09576811

    Products Usage

    Pyrazosulfuron-ethyl is a herbicide used primarily in agriculture. It is widely used in rice fields and the land surrounding rice to control the growth of weeds, thereby increasing rice yield and quality.  Pyrazosulfuron-ethyl achieves weedicidal effects by inhibiting weed growth and photosynthesis. However, strict safety operating procedures need to be followed when using it to ensure safety for humans and the environment.

    Storage:
    Store the container tightly closed in a dry, cool and well-ventilated place. Store apart from foodstuff containers or incompatible materials.

    Safety Protection

    Precautions for safe handling
    Handling in a well ventilated place. Wear suitable protective clothing. Avoid contact with skin and eyes. Avoid formation of dust and aerosols. Use non-sparking tools. Prevent fire caused by electrostatic discharge steam.
